CFD for spray optimization
In carbon capture, the spray itself plays a crucial role in removing CO₂ from industrial gases. The process uses a liquid called an amine solution, which chemically binds with carbon dioxide.
Inside the absorption tower, the flue gas rises upward while a network of nozzles sprays a fine mist of amine droplets downward. The spray increases the surface area ratio optimizing the contact between the amine and the CO2 rich gas for better absorption.
